A man facing allegations related to a bomb hoax at one of Peter Kay’s performances was forcibly removed from a court hearing after he attempted to remove his clothing. Courtroom Incident Unfolds
The hearing took place at a local magistrates’ court where the suspect was appearing to answer charges linked to an alleged bomb threat made during a highly anticipated comedy show by the renowned comedian, Peter Kay. Witnesses reported that as the proceedings began, the accused became increasingly agitated, culminating in his attempt to undress in front of court officials and attendees.
Security personnel swiftly intervened, escorting the man out of the courtroom. Eyewitness accounts suggest that his behaviour was erratic, possibly indicating a need for mental health assessment. Context of the Allegations
The accused is alleged to have made a bomb threat during Kay’s performance, which was met with immediate action from law enforcement and venue security. Details surrounding the specific nature of the threat remain limited as the case is ongoing, but it has undoubtedly caused distress among attendees and the wider community.

Peter Kay, a beloved figure in British comedy, has attracted large audiences with his shows, making the incident all the more shocking. The alleged hoax not only endangered the safety of many but also disrupted a night meant for laughter and enjoyment.
